Output 5156c0426d76a7212031fb02e4289e01afed095523c0b98ba8856beef7dd277e:1

value
1156151
script pubkey
OP_0 OP_PUSHBYTES_20 d68e9f423d11e3ecc3df9aea7c5454296cc24cb9
address
bc1q668f7s3az837es7lnt48c4z599kvyn9exlfpzf
transaction
5156c0426d76a7212031fb02e4289e01afed095523c0b98ba8856beef7dd277e